Silken Tofu Strawberry Smoothie

This silken tofu strawberry smoothie is healthy, creamy and full of nutrition, and very easy to make.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 0 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
ESTIMATED COST : $2.03 a serve
Course Breakfast, Drinks, Snack
Cuisine Western
Servings 1 x 390 ml (1 ¾ cup)
Calories 218 kcal

Equipment

  • Blender, food processor, or stick blender

Ingredients
  

  • 50 grams (1.76 ounces) of silken tofu
  • 187 ml (¾ cup) soy milk or other plant milk or dairy
  • 50 grams (1.76 ounces, ½ small) ripe banana
  • 90 grams (3.25 ounces, ¾ cup) strawberries, frozen
  • 1 tablespoon maple syrup or your sweetener of choice

Instructions
 

  • Place the tofu, milk, banana, frozen strawberries, and maple syrup into a food processor and blend until smooth.
  • Taste for flavor and blend in more sweetener or milk if necessary to get your desired taste and consistency. Pour into a tall glass and enjoy.
